GAM is a free, open source command line tool for Google Apps Administrators to manage domain and user settings quickly and easily. GAM supports
- creating, deleting, and updating users, aliases, groups, organizations, and resource calendars
- modifying user email settings such as IMAP, signatures, vacation messages, profile sharing, email forwarding, send as address, labels, and features.
- modifying calendar access rights for users and resource calendars.
- generating detailed reports for users, groups, resources, account activity, email clients, and quotas.
- and many more commands
